exploding but keep the clip

It doesn't happen very often but sometimes it would be nice to explode a xcliped block while keeping the stuff inside the clip boundary and trimming/discarding everything outside the clip boundary. Is anyone aware of a routine to do this? Thanks!

I've tried that, but when you explode the block you get the whole block showing up not just the clipped part. As an example, we have some building sections that we've xref'd into a sheet and then clipped to get just the details we want. We want to see if we can find an easy way of just getting the clipped part so we can add the details to our detail library without having to trim, erase, etc. the remainder of the drawing. Obviously, there are ways to get the job done but the operative word here is "easy" (translate as fast and mindless). Thanks again
